Output 39f313c86fe4a96e8786e7df1972367ef42c84d80da7f8c0c039343b816217ee:9

value
582578580253
script pubkey
OP_0 OP_PUSHBYTES_20 034bc01872b13e20bf196662beb333cc510f3893
address
ltc1qqd9uqxrjkylzp0ceve3tavene3gs7wynjfh2zl
transaction
39f313c86fe4a96e8786e7df1972367ef42c84d80da7f8c0c039343b816217ee
spent
true